Why is Elmo on Google?

By sarahness on November 8, 2009

Today, November 8 2009, is Elmo’s turn to be the star in Google’s search page. Google has been featuring Sesame Street characters in line with the show’s 40th anniversary on November 10.

elmo

Elmo is a furry red monster with large white eyes and an orange nose. He likes learning, laughing, looking at books, and playing.

Oscar the Grouch is the latest Sesame Street character in the Google’s page.

oscar

Google is featuring these Sesame Street characters in line with the long running television show’s 40th anniversary, which will be celebrated on November 10.

“I love Trash”. Sesame Street’s resident Grouch has a green body, has no nose, and lives in a garbage can. He likes collecting junk, rainy days, and arguing. He has two pets, Slimey (a worm) and Fluffy (an elephant).

Through Oscar, children actually learn about respect and tolerance instead of disrespect and intolerance, and they discover that people with different views and lifestyles can still be great friends.

Bert and Ernie from Sesame Street grace today’s google logo. Google has been celebrating the 40th anniversary of Sesame Street this entire week. The Sesame Street’s 40th anniversary is on Nov 10. So, Google will have four more Sesame Street’s characters. Who’s next?

bert_ernie-hp

Bert and Ernie are two roommates on the long-running television show. They were built by Don Sahlin from a simple design scribbled by Muppets creator Jim Henson.

Google Dashboard

By sarahness on November 5, 2009

Google launched a new service, Google Dashboard, that shows summary of the data stored with a Google account, enabling us to monitor and manage google’s array of services.


gdashboard


Google Dashboard shows what data is being stored on Google services. It also provides a summary of the data in these services you use while signed in.

As quoted from Google’s blog, Google Dashboard is a long answer to the question: “What does Google know about me?”.

It is now available at http://www.google.com/dashboard

Earth-like Planet Discovered

By sarahness on November 3, 2009

corot-7b

Astronomers discovered an earth-like planet orbiting around the star COROT-7. The planet was named COROT-7b. The composition is somewhat similar to Earth’s, a rocky one, but with less iron and/or more water.
